Fried Yellow Perch Fillet

Fried yellow perch fillet is a popular dish known for its delicate flavor and flaky texture. Rich in protein and essential nutrients, it is a nutritious choice for seafood lovers.

High in protein, which is essential for muscle repair and growth.
Contains omega-3 fatty acids that support heart health and reduce inflammation.

Amberjack Yellowtail Fillet

Amberjack yellowtail fillet is a lean, high-protein fish known for its firm texture and mild flavor. It is rich in omega-3 fatty acids, making it a heart-healthy choice.

High in protein, which is essential for muscle repair and growth.
R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which support cardiovascular health and reduce inflammation.
